Budweiser Ends FA Cup Sponsorship After Three Years To Focus On World Cup

Budweiser "has confirmed its plans to end its sponsorship of the FA Cup" at the end of the '14-15 season, "focusing its attention instead on its deal with FIFA to sponsor the next three World Cups," according to Alex Brownsell of MARKETING MAGAZINE. The Anheuser-Busch InBev-owned beer brand "took over from energy firm E.ON as title partner in 2012, with plans to build a global audience for the FA Cup to match competitions such as the Premier League and the Champions League" (MARKETING MAGAZINE, 2/10). The BBC reported Budweiser "was the first U.S. sponsor of English football's FA Cup." There have been reports that the FA "would consider offering naming rights for the trophy, but it is understood it is seeking a similar arrangement to the existing deal." Under this deal, Budweiser is "in association with" the FA Cup (BBC, 2/7).
